Helluva Boss is Helluva Show

An online-only cartoon is bring shrieks of delight to morbid viewers

Demon imps Millie, Blitzo, and Moxxie enter an old building to fulfill one of their assassin contracts in the adult animated series Helluva Boss. The animated series about demonic hitmen has exploded in popularity over the past six months, making it one of the most popular channels on YouTube. While very bloody and very shocking, Helluva Boss is also very well made, very well acted, and very entertaining overall.

The past few years have been great for adult animation. From Rick and Morty blowing up to the success of Bojack Horseman on Netflix, it seems that cartoons for adults are everywhere. Yet one of the most popular series isn’t on a network or streaming service: it’s on YouTube, and it’s getting more views than The Simpsons.

Helluva Boss is an adult animation series that is beyond humorous and just overall entertaining. The background and storyline of this show are just creative and out-of-the-box thinking. Created by Vivienne Medrano, the series spun out of the pilot for a series called Hazbin Hotel, which was picked up by A24 and will be released sometime next year. Although the show was released in 2019, Helluva Boss has shown an uprising in views and a growth of audience and viewers. 

Like Hazbin Hotel, Helluva Boss takes place in a vibrantly colorful underworld. In Hell, the lowest of the low people are imps, creatures born in Hell to a servant class. But one imp named Blitzo (the o is silent) feels like he can get a rise in popularity and wealth by starting his own business, the Immediate Murder Professionals. Thanks to a favor granted by a demon prince, Blitzo is able to go to the mortal realm where he works as a hitman for souls in Hell who want revenge against the living. Blitzo hires fellow assassins Moxxie and Millie, an imp couple that specializes in weaponry and combat, as well as his adopted hellhound Loona. 

Over the series, Blitzo and his crew start getting into Hell’s public eye as more and more people start to come and ask them for favors. While each episode is very different, each one is carried by rapid-fire humor, intense violence, and at least one musical number (yeh, this show bout Hell is a musical). While each episode works on its own, they all align into a continuing storyline where we learn more about the politics of Hell and the inner lives of the characters. The episodes also feature a rich, detailed art style that goes beyond what is normally seen on YouTube. The sleek angles on characters and saturated backgrounds make the show both unlike anything on TV or streaming yet that same quality.

Hellhound Loona (Erica Lindbeck) snarls as anti-demon government agents surround Moxxie (Richard Steven Horvitz), Blitzo (Brandon Rodgers), and Millie (Vivian Nixon) in Helluva Boss Episode 6. Unlike many YouTube projects, Helluva Boss features professional voice talents from series like Invader Zim, Spiderman, Glee, and The Good Wife as well as celebrities Norman Reedus (The Walking Dead) and Mara Wilson (Matilda).

 

This show has everything that an animated show needs: the voice animation is on point, the humor, the character and their roles, and the overall production of the show is all perfectly well done. Each and every one of the characters introduced throughout the seven episodes is lovable and so fun to watch. The big boss Blitzo is the head and founder of I.M.P. Blitzo always wanted what was best for his company and tried constantly to always be professional, but with the kind of coworkers he has, it’s almost impossible. Even though he can be disrespectful, rude, or selfish, he always makes sure everyone’s doing good. Moxie who is married to Millie is a gun specialist. Although a lot may think he’s too shy or weak to kill, he definitely has his moments to prove you wrong. Millie is Moxie’s complete opposite: she is bold, fearless, and downright funny. She is always ready to have fun and is so lively and cheerful. Although all of the characters are completely different, they all work together to make a strong team and successful company. 

This show was hilarious but it is humor that can be sensitive to some viewers. Helluva Boss is definitely for an older and more mature audience, as it has graphic killing scenes, some sexual content (but no nudity), and obscene language that would make a sailor blush.  But mature content should be expected for a series that literally takes place in Hell. While it won’t fit everybody’s tastes, Helluva Boss is a very impressive show, as seen by its impressive view counts (over 1 million views on each day a new episode is released). If you love dark humor, bloody violence, and action-packed animated shows, this show is definitely the one for you. You can find the entire series to date on the Vivzipop Youtube channel.
